闫宝龙博客-专注SEO&SEM营销与短视频推广的实战专家
网站性能优化是提升用户体验、增加用户粘性、提高搜索引擎排名的关键因素。在互联网竞争日益激烈的今天,一个响应速度快、加载时间短的网站无疑能够给用户带来更好的访问体验。本文将围绕如何进行网站性能优化展开讨论,从多个角度提供优化策略。
一、优化网站内容
1. 减少HTTP请求:通过合并CSS、JavaScript文件,使用精灵图等技术减少HTTP请求次数,从而提高页面加载速度。
2. 压缩图片:使用图片压缩工具对图片进行压缩,减少图片文件大小,降低加载时间。
3. 使用CDN:通过CDN(内容分发网络)将静态资源分发到全球各地的节点,用户访问时直接从最近的节点获取资源,减少延迟。
4. 优化CSS和JavaScript:去除不必要的代码,使用CSS3和JavaScript新特性,提高代码执行效率。
二、优化服务器配置
1. 选择合适的虚拟主机:根据网站流量选择合适的虚拟主机,避免服务器过载。
2. 使用缓存:配置服务器缓存,如Apache的mod_cache、Nginx的FastCGI缓存等,减少数据库查询次数,提高响应速度。
3. 优化数据库:对数据库进行优化,如索引优化、查询优化等,提高数据库访问效率。
4. 使用负载均衡:通过负载均衡技术,将用户请求分发到多个服务器,提高服务器处理能力。
三、优化网络传输
1. 使用HTTP/2:HTTP/2协议具有多路复用、服务器推送等特性,可以提高页面加载速度。
2. 减少DNS查询:优化DNS解析,减少DNS查询次数,提高访问速度。
3. 使用Web字体:将Web字体转换为字体图标,减少字体文件大小,提高加载速度。
4. 使用WebP格式:WebP格式具有更好的压缩效果,可以减少图片文件大小,提高加载速度。
四、优化前端技术
1. 使用异步加载:将JavaScript文件异步加载,避免阻塞页面渲染。
2. 使用懒加载:对图片、视频等资源进行懒加载,减少初始加载时间。
3. 使用框架和库:合理使用前端框架和库,提高开发效率,降低代码冗余。
4. 优化CSS选择器:使用简洁的CSS选择器,提高CSS渲染效率。
五、监控与评估
1. 使用性能监控工具:定期使用性能监控工具对网站进行性能测试,了解网站性能状况。
2. 分析用户反馈:关注用户反馈,了解用户对网站性能的满意度。
3. 持续优化:根据测试结果和用户反馈,持续优化网站性能。
网站性能优化是一个持续的过程,需要从多个角度进行综合考虑。通过优化网站内容、服务器配置、网络传输、前端技术以及监控与评估,可以有效提升网站性能,为用户提供更好的访问体验。
来源:闫宝龙(微信/QQ号:18097696),网站内容转载请保留出处和链接!
YBL.CN网站内容版权声明: